【问题标题】:Not able to display images in Jekyll's posts无法在 Jekyll 的帖子中显示图像
【发布时间】:2020-04-15 13:17:42
【问题描述】:

在我的 Jekyll 博客中,我有一个名为 _documents 的集合,我在其中发布比平时更重要的帖子。由于我使用的是降价,因此我可以使用代码![](./../assets/images/test.png) 在这些帖子中发布图像。由于这篇文章的发布日期并不重要,因此文件的名称不以日期开头。

然后我在 _posts 文件夹中有标准帖子。当我尝试在其中发布图像时,URL 会通过添加年份和前一个月来更改。例如,应该是https://name.github.io/blog/assets/images/test.pnghttps://name.github.io/blog/2020/04/assets/images/test.png 并且图像不会加载。

如何确保 Jekyll 在引用图像时不使用日期? 谢谢

【问题讨论】:

    标签: markdown jekyll github-pages


    【解决方案1】:

    尝试将降价设置为:

    ![](/assets/images/test.png)
    

    如果这不起作用,请查看控制台 (F12) 中是否有任何错误,例如图像上的 404 Not Found 错误。

    【讨论】:

    • 它或多或少有效。我必须写:![](/blog/assets/images/test.png)
    • 是的,这完全取决于您在_config.yml 中设置永久链接的方式。我通常将其设置为permalink: "/blog/:title/"。根据您的设置进行相应调整。
    猜你喜欢
    • 2020-08-27
    • 1970-01-01
    • 2023-03-30
    • 2018-11-19
    • 2018-07-09
    • 2014-01-19
    • 1970-01-01
    • 2018-03-22
    • 2015-02-25
    相关资源
    最近更新 更多